Concern Has Been Expressed For The Future Of South Doc In Cork Which Has Been Described As A System Under Strain

It comes after reports that the out-of-hours GP service is struggling to staff shifts
It emerged last week that a text message was sent seeking 'urgent cover' for the Kinsale Rd service.
It's understood the message was sent shortly before 6pm when the shift was due to commence.
